Technologia blockchain to jedno z najważniejszych osiągnięć technologicznych ostatniej dekady, które zrewolucjonizowało zarządzanie danymi, bezpieczeństwo transakcji oraz przepływ informacji. Najbardziej znana jest jako podstawa kryptowalut, takich jak Bitcoin, ale jej zastosowania wykraczają daleko poza świat cyfrowych walut. Niniejszy artykuł przedstawia podstawowe pojęcia, zasady działania oraz potencjalne zastosowania technologii blockchain.
Blockchain to zdecentralizowana, rozproszona cyfrowa księga, która rejestruje transakcje na wielu komputerach. Dzięki temu dane są bezpieczne, przejrzyste i niezmienne. Istota blockchaina polega na organizowaniu informacji w „bloki”, które są łączone w łańcuch w porządku chronologicznym, stąd nazwa.
Decentralizacja: Nie ma centralnego organu kontrolującego system. Dane są rozproszone na wielu węzłach (nodes), co uniemożliwia jednej jednostce pełną kontrolę.
Przejrzystość: Transakcje są widoczne dla wszystkich uczestników sieci, co zwiększa zaufanie.
Nieodwracalność: Dane zapisane w blokach są niezwykle trudne do zmiany, ponieważ każdy blok jest powiązany kryptograficznymi funkcjami haszującymi.
Bezpieczeństwo: Techniki kryptograficzne, takie jak hashe i podpisy cyfrowe, zapewniają integralność danych i autentyczność transakcji.
Aby zrozumieć działanie blockchaina, prześledźmy krok po kroku proces zapisywania transakcji:
Inicjacja transakcji: Użytkownik inicjuje transakcję, np. przekazanie kryptowaluty.
Tworzenie bloku: Transakcja jest zapisywana w nowym bloku, który zawiera szczegóły transakcji, znacznik czasu i hash poprzedniego bloku.
Mechanizm konsensusu: Węzły sieci weryfikują ważność transakcji za pomocą algorytmu konsensusu (np. Proof of Work lub Proof of Stake).
Dodanie bloku do łańcucha: Po zatwierdzeniu blok jest dodawany do łańcucha, a wszystkie węzły synchronizują dane.
Finalizacja: Transakcja staje się częścią blockchaina i jest nieodwracalna.
Hash: Unikalny ciąg znaków o stałej długości generowany z danych. Zmiana danych powoduje zmianę hasha.
Algorytm konsensusu: Zestaw reguł zapewniających, że wszyscy uczestnicy sieci zgadzają się co do ważności transakcji.
Inteligentne kontrakty: Samowykonujące się programy, które automatycznie realizują warunki umowy, gdy zostaną spełnione.
Chociaż blockchain został pierwotnie opracowany dla Bitcoina, obecnie znajduje zastosowanie w wielu branżach:
Finanse: Blockchain umożliwia szybkie, tanie i bezpieczne transakcje transgraniczne. Na przykład sieć Ripple oferuje takie rozwiązania dla banków.
Łańcuch dostaw: Blockchain zapewnia przejrzystość w śledzeniu ruchu towarów, np. w przemyśle spożywczym lub farmaceutycznym.
Ochrona zdrowia: Bezpieczne przechowywanie i udostępnianie danych medycznych przy zachowaniu prywatności pacjentów.
Głosowanie: Systemy oparte na blockchainie mogą zwiększyć przejrzystość i bezpieczeństwo wyborów.
NFT i sztuka cyfrowa: Tokeny niewymienne (NFT) wykorzystują blockchain do rejestrowania własności aktywów cyfrowych.
Bezpieczeństwo: Kryptograficzne zabezpieczenia utrudniają włamania.
Przejrzystość: Dane są dostępne dla wszystkich uczestników.
Efektywność: Transakcje bez pośredników zmniejszają koszty i czas.
Skalowalność: Blockchainy, takie jak Bitcoin, mogą być wolne przy dużej liczbie transakcji.
Zużycie energii: Algorytmy Proof of Work wymagają znacznej ilości energii.
Regulacje: Technologia blockchain wciąż napotyka wyzwania prawne i regulacyjne.
Technologia blockchain stale się rozwija. Nowe generacje blockchainów, takie jak Ethereum 2.0 czy Cardano, są szybsze i bardziej energooszczędne. Inteligentne kontrakty i zdecentralizowane finanse (DeFi) wprowadzają dalsze innowacje, które mogą zmienić globalną gospodarkę. Rządy i korporacje na całym świecie coraz bardziej dostrzegają potencjał blockchaina, a jego adopcja prawdopodobnie będzie się rozszerzać.
Technologia blockchain oferuje unikalne połączenie decentralizacji, bezpieczeństwa i przejrzystości. Pomimo istniejących wyzwań, udowodniła swoją wartość w wielu branżach i w przyszłości może mieć jeszcze większy wpływ na społeczeństwo. Zrozumienie blockchaina jest kluczowe dla każdego, kto chce nadążyć za innowacjami ery cyfrowej.